Event Description: The local classic car club of Wervik(Belgium) proudly invites you to his 20th International Oldtimer Meeting This event is considered as the largest free classic car & oldtimer meeting in Belgium and northern France.
Car Type: All classics
Number of Cars Attending: 700ish
Times: 7:00 to 19:00
Location: Oosthove city park and surroundings in Wervik

Event Description: ***This event is cancelled*** Rotary Club of Tewkesbury stage their annual Classic Vehicle Festival at Tewkesbury School Playing Fields. The Festival features live vintage entertainment courtesy of the Haywood Sisters, Lindy Hop dance dancers, plus 110 quality trade stands including car accessories, memorabilia, autojumble and a wide selection of onsite catering.
Thanks to the tremendous success of the Tewkesbury Classic Vehicle Festival event in August 2018, the Rotary Club of Tewkesbury were able to make a number of donations, including £6000 to the Midlands Air Ambulance Charity and £3000 to Sue Ryder Leckhampton Court Hospice.

Event Description: ***Sadly not being held in 2027 but returning in August 2026****The Great Dorset Steam fair is one of the Country leading steam traction events but still has a significant Classic car presence. One of the highlights of The Great Dorset Steam Fair is the old time steam Funfair. Annually, over 60 Showman's Engines with their gleaming, twisted, brass appear generating the light and power for the old roundabouts and swing-boats.
